                The perimeter of a rectangular garden is 44 yards. It's length is 5 yards less than double the width. Find the length and the width of the garden.

    2 L + 2 W = 44 ... L + W = 22
L = 2 W - 5
substituting ... 2 W - 5 + W = 22
solve for W , then substitute back to find L
